I. Key Elements of User Experience:

To effectively measure the user experience, it is essential to understand the key elements that contribute to it. These elements include usability, satisfaction, and engagement.

A. Usability:

Usability refers to the ease with which users can interact with a product or service. It encompasses factors such as learnability, efficiency, and error prevention. Measuring usability involves assessing the effectiveness, efficiency, and satisfaction users experience while completing specific tasks. Usability metrics, such as task success rate, time on task, and error rate, provide valuable insights into the usability of a digital product or service.

B. Satisfaction:

User satisfaction plays a pivotal role in determining the overall user experience. It reflects users’ subjective perception of the product or service and their level of contentment. To measure satisfaction, feedback surveys, such as the System Usability Scale (SUS) or the Net Promoter Score (NPS), can be employed. These surveys capture users’ opinions and perceptions, providing quantitative data to evaluate and improve the UX.

C. Engagement:

Engagement refers to users’ level of involvement, interest, and interaction with a digital product or service. Measuring engagement metrics can help assess how well a design captivates and retains users’ attention. Metrics such as time spent on page, click-through rates, and bounce rates can provide insights into user engagement and help identify areas for improvement.

II. Quantitative Methods for Measuring User Experience:

Quantitative methods rely on numerical data to measure and analyze the user experience. They provide valuable insights into user behavior and allow for statistical analysis. Two common quantitative methods for measuring UX are surveys and analytics.

A. Surveys:

Surveys are a popular and effective method for collecting user feedback. They can be used to gather information about users’ preferences, satisfaction levels, and specific pain points. Surveys like the SUS or NPS mentioned earlier are widely used to assess user satisfaction and overall UX perception. By distributing well-designed surveys and analyzing the results, you can uncover valuable insights and identify areas for improvement.

B. Analytics and Metrics:

Utilizing analytics tools and metrics is another effective way to measure UX. By collecting data on user behavior, interactions, and conversions, you can gain valuable insights into the effectiveness of your design. Tools like Google Analytics provide a wealth of information, including page views, session duration, conversion rates, and more. By setting up relevant UX-focused metrics and analyzing the data, you can gain a deeper understanding of user interactions and make data-driven decisions to enhance the UX.

III. Qualitative Methods for Measuring User Experience:

While quantitative methods provide numerical data, qualitative methods focus on gathering rich, subjective insights into the user experience. Qualitative methods help uncover users’ motivations, emotions, and pain points, leading to a deeper understanding of their needs and expectations.

A. Interviews and User Testing:

Directly engaging with users through interviews and user testing sessions allows for in-depth exploration of their experiences. Through interviews, you can ask open-ended questions and gain detailed insights into their thoughts, opinions, and challenges. User testing involves observing users as they interact with your product or service, providing valuable feedback on usability and uncovering potential areas for improvement. By incorporating these qualitative methods, you can gain a holistic understanding of the user experience and identify specific areas that require attention.

B. User Observation and Ethnography:

Observing users in their natural environment, commonly known as user observation or ethnography, can provide valuable insights into their behavior and preferences. By immersing yourself in the users’ context, you can gain a deeper understanding of their motivations, challenges, and how they interact with your product or service. This qualitative method allows you to identify pain points, unmet needs, and opportunities for enhancing the user experience.

IV. Remote and Automated User Experience Measurement:

In today’s digital age, remote testing and automated user experience measurement have gained significant traction, offering convenience and scalability in collecting user data.

A. Remote Testing:

Remote testing allows you to gather user feedback from a geographically diverse pool of participants. It eliminates the need for physical presence and enables you to test usability and gather feedback remotely. Remote testing can be conducted through various methods, such as remote moderated sessions, unmoderated remote tests, or remote user surveys. Remote testing offers flexibility, cost-effectiveness, and the ability to reach a larger audience. It allows you to gather valuable insights on the user experience across different demographics and geographical locations.

B. Automated UX Measurement:

Automated UX measurement involves leveraging technology and tools to collect and analyze data on user interactions. Heatmaps, clickstream analysis, and session recordings are examples of automated tools that provide valuable insights into user behavior. These tools track user interactions, identify patterns, and highlight areas of improvement. Automated UX measurement offers efficiency, scalability, and real-time data, enabling you to make informed decisions for enhancing the user experience.
